The new data paper is published in the journal "Biodiversity Data Journal" online version
The new data paper is published in the journal “Biodiversity Data Journal” online version. This paper reports on insect and plant observation records based on the collection of photographs with GPS data through a citizen-participatory survey. A crowdsourcing approach to collecting photo-based insect and plant observation records. Authors: Takeshi Osawa (Institute for Agro-Environmental Sciences, NARO, Tsukuba, Japan) et al. Data is available on GBIF portal.

The new data paper is published in the journal "Mycology" online version
The new data paper is published in the journal “Mycology” online version. In this paper, the authors have developed and published a checklist of fungi that occur on beech, a tree endemic to Japan. A check list of non-lichenised fungi occurring on Fagus crenata, a tree endemic to Japan. Authors: Tsuyoshi Hosoya (Department of Botany, National Museum of Nature and Science, Tsukuba, Japan) et al.

The new data paper is published in the journal "Biodiversity Data Journal" online version
The new data paper is published in the journal “Biodiversity Data Journal” online version. This is the result of three years of spider monitoring in natural and artificial forests on Yakushima Island, where specimens were organized and label information was made available as open data. Specimen records of spiders (Arachnida: Araneae) by monthly census for 3 years in forest areas of Yakushima Island, Japan Authors: Takeshi Osawa (Institute for Agro-environmental Sciences, Tsukuba, Japan) et al. ...
